Snippet
The photoreactions of CazidocoumaIins (I) and 3-azidocoumarin (2) in the presence of nucleophiles such as alcohols, thiol or mines generally gave 4-substituted 3-amino-and/or 3- substituted 4-aminocoumarins, while pyrone ring fiion with inwrporation of two moles of …
